skybytch 273 #4 July 4, 2001 They are also true sportsmen. The Russian team missed the plane for the third round of 8 way - they were in the running for medals with France and the US when it happened. The Airspeed guys (along with the other 8 way teams) petitioned the judges to allow the Russians to rejump their round 3. Russia ended up winning gold by one point in the third round!Congrats to the Russian 8 way team!!!pull and flare,lisa----I don't think much, therefore I might not be Quote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
